78046 vs 93307
Side-by-side comparison (2022 Census data).
| Metric | 78046 | 93307 |
|---|---|---|
| State | Texas | California |
| Population | 69,422 | 89,651 |
| Median Income | $51,667 | $50,157 |
| Median Home Value | $131,900 | $220,400 |
| Median Rent | $984 | $1,111 |
| Median Age | 26.0 | 27.2 |
| Poverty Rate | 26.7% | 26.7% |
| Bachelor's Degree+ | 12.1% | 7.6% |
| Homeownership | 78.5% | 48.7% |
| Unemployment | 6.3% | 10.0% |
